Frequently Asked Questions about Granger
What type of rentals are currently available in Granger?
There are currently 48 Apartments for Rent in Granger, IN with pricing that ranges from $790 to $5,100. There are also 38 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Granger ranging from $850 to $4,800.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Granger?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Granger ranges from $850 to $4,800 with an average monthly rent of $1,616.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Granger?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Granger range from $790 to $4,899,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,150 to $4,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,750 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$949.
